How do killer whales hear and talk?

Orcas speak by producing noises and clicks known as sonars at a certain frequency which is like how humans speak. Orcas hear by receiving sonar and other sounds through the lower jaw bone to be transmitted to the inner ear. This is possible as the lower jaw bone is hollow.
